Why live-event networks overload—and what that means for smart homes
High-density usage patterns
In a packed stadium, thousands of devices generate concurrent signaling (push notifications, GPS updates, social posts, ticket scanning) that tie up control-plane resources and spectrum. The result: slower app refreshes, delayed push notifications, and timeouts when smartphones try to reach cloud services that control home devices.
Applications most affected
Home automation flows vulnerable to latency include remote unlocks, video doorbell streaming, alarm notifications, and two-factor authentication for device control. If an app times out, automations can fail or act on old state. For broader guidance on setting up home tech for stress times, see Home Tech Upgrades for Family Fun.

Preparing your smart home for events: step-by-step checklist
1) Audit critical automations and alerts
List automations you depend on remotely: door locks, alarm disarm, HVAC overrides, water/temperature alerts, garage controls. Prioritize which need guaranteed delivery and which can be delayed. A small audit helps you implement fallback options.
2) Add multi-channel notifications
Where supported, enable SMS and email duplicates for critical alerts. SMS often follows different carrier lanes and can act as a backup. Also consider push-to-voice options or VOIP alerts if you use services that support them.
3) Configure local control and routines
Whenever possible, keep safe defaults that do not require remote confirmation (for example, auto-lock schedules, local motion-triggered lights). Our home tech upgrades piece explains how local automation can reduce reliance on the cloud.
Device and network setup recommendations for event resilience
Router, QoS, and mesh tips
Ensure your home router firmware is current and configure Quality of Service (QoS) to prioritize security and alert traffic. If guests will be in your home, create a guest SSID with bandwidth limits. Smartphone preparedness
Install app updates before you leave, enable offline caching where available, and confirm that push notifications are allowed. eSIM and cross-carrier options
If you frequently attend high-density events, consider an eSIM plan on a second carrier as a fallback, or ensure family members use a mix of carriers to avoid simultaneous outages. Turbo Live only helps AT&T subscribers in participating venues, so a secondary carrier can provide resilience.

Two-factor auth and reliability
Two-factor authentication (2FA) can fail when SMS or push is delayed. Use app-based authenticators, backup codes, or hardware keys for critical device control, and verify fallback methods before events.

Troubleshooting and support: what to do if your commands fail
Immediate steps
If an unlock, alarm, or alert doesn't go through: check app connectivity, use backup codes or hardware keys, and have a neighbor or trusted guest on-site with keys. Post-event diagnostics
Review logs from your smart home hub and device apps to identify timed-out calls or failed authentications. Use those insights to adjust automations and add redundancy for the next event.
